Annual, 30-150 cm, glabrous or sparingly hairy. Stems weak, branched. Leaves petiolate, pinnate with 3-5 leaflets; leaflets ovate, serrate; terminal leaflet petiolulate, lateral leaflets sessile or decurrent. Heads about 1 cm in diameter, discoid or with very short white ray-florets; disc-florets yellow. Outer involucral bracts oblong, connate at base; inner bracts longer and broader. Achenes linear-tetragonal, 8-10 x 1 mm, ribbed, minutely tuberculate and sparsely strigulose; marginal achenes shorter, compressed. Pappus-awns 2-4.
